Carly and Kris's wedding celebration at Tudor Park, Bearsted

When we met Carly and Kris on one very cold winter's day, we immediately "hit it off" and knew that their style was similar to ours. They didn't want "run of the mill" flowers but equally wanted some simple, striking and slightly quirky. Their theme was purple (our favourite) and silver which is always a lovely combination and as they were really excited about the use of the purple anthurium, the design evolved from there. Even though we were early delivering the flowers and the tables weren't quite complete, we think the arrangements worked so well within a marquee style setting, giving an elegance and stature whilst remaining essentially quite simple.

Carly and Kris' wedding plans changed over a period of time and they decided to keep their ceremony simple and intimate and actually got married overseas. However, they wanted their reception to be exactly the same, and hence we made no changes at all to the tablecentres. We used Previa anthuriums, deep purple gladioli, silver bear grass and silvered birch (which isn't easily seen in these photos but looked lovely glinting in the light). All were tied with silver ribbon to give to guests. The simple addition of the water colour completed the look.

For the top table, we wanted to keep the look the same, and yet allow the speeches to be accessible to all, so we merely used smaller vases and kept the design exactly the same. This gave the synergy we wanted throughout.

Whilst we wouldn't want all our guests to get married overseas (we love making bridal bouquets), Carly and Kris had the best of all worlds and ended up with a wedding and a reception that suited their styles, their dreams and their personalities ....and gave them two causes to celebrate!
